In the latest world ranking issued today, there are 6 Malaysian men singles players ranked in the top 24, namely: Lee Chong Wei (#6) Wong Choong Hann (#7) Hafiz Hashim (#9) Roslin Hashim (#20) Sairul Amar Ayob (#22) Kuan Beng Hong (#23) So, Malaysia is almost certain to be eligible for sending 3 MS entries. Some changes in the Malaysian ranking seen after the Thai and Japan Open. Lee CW - moved up to #5 (all time career high) Hafiz Hashim - the new Malaysian no 2 at world #8 spot Wong CH - dropped out of top 10, now ranked 11 Kuan BH - reached his career high at world #14 Sairul Amar - world #20 Roslin Hashim - world #21 No doubt, Lee CW and Hafiz has virtually seal their LA ticket. Who will be the 3rd player for Malaysia? Kuan BH has been making waves lately, and can be deemed as serious threat to Wong CH.
